The Polar Bear
I dwell in the Arctic Ocean, And cope with cold, ice and snow, I'm a large predator, And create fear wherever i go, I'm Ursus Maritimus - the Maritime Bear, I hunt for fish beneath the ice, I know they are there, I'm gorgeous and cuddly, But you best beware, If i ever catch you, You'll be fixed by my steely glare.
